The key purpose of the school counselor performance evaluation is to enhance the positive effect the school coun-selor and the school counseling program have on students and school stakeholders (VSCA, 2008). A school counseling program is an articulated, sequential, kindergarten-through-grade 12 program that is comprehensive in scope, preventative in design, developmental in nature, driven by data, and integral to the school district's curricula and instructional program. The annual performance evaluation of school counselors should accurately reflect the unique professional training and practices of school counselors working within a comprehensive school counseling program.
